Transaction 6fd730cc27fdbddc83d7c6bc6964c35a56780788065cde7213a40d4cfabaaf72
1 Input
1 Output
-
6fd730cc27fdbddc83d7c6bc6964c35a56780788065cde7213a40d4cfabaaf72:0
- value
- 681670
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d8524b8185a8b655416128aaeebb58bac113f7f
- address
- bc1qmkzjfwqct29k24qkz292a6a43wkpz0mlxvuwn0